Abstract

Preconception care significantly improves maternal and child health but remains inconsistently implemented globally. Mobile health (mHealth) applications leveraging mobile technology are increasingly explored to deliver preconception interventions. The effectiveness of these apps may depend on their design, with strategies such as gamification, theory-driven frameworks, and human-centered design enhancing user engagement and behavioral outcomes. However, the application of these design strategies in preconception mHealth apps lacks systematic analysis. This systematic review protocol, adhering to PRISMA-P guidelines, aims to synthesize quantitative evidence on mHealth apps incorporating these design strategies. Studies from 2014-2024 evaluating such apps among reproductive-aged women will be identified through PubMed, Scopus, and Web of Science. Peer-reviewed quantitative studies, including randomized controlled trials, nonrandomized trials, and cohort studies, will be considered, while qualitative studies, reviews, and studies lacking empirical outcome data will be excluded. A comprehensive search strategy will combine key terms for preconception care and mobile health applications, with further evaluation of design-related and outcome-related terms during the title/abstract screening and full-text review stages. The review will categorize app design strategies and assess their effectiveness in improving preconception knowledge, awareness, behavioral intention, behavior change, engagement, usability, satisfaction, and adherence. Given the expected heterogeneity among the studies, a narrative synthesis following the Synthesis Without a Meta-analysis framework will be conducted, with subgroup analyses to explore design features and outcome variations. The findings will guide app developers, policymakers, and healthcare professionals while identifying gaps in the existing evidence base and highlighting areas for further research in digital reproductive health.
